Anti-aging drugs are medications or supplements that aim to slow down or reverse the effects of aging on the body, such as reducing wrinkles and age spots, improving cognitive function, and increasing longevity. These drugs may target specific biological processes that contribute to aging, such as oxidative stress, inflammation, and cell regeneration. However, the effectiveness and safety of many anti-aging drugs are still under investigation, and some may have adverse side effects.
